Mahama assures of proactive steps to address economic challenges

In a keynote address at the Chinese Lantern Festival Gala held at the University of Ghana Sports Stadium on February 9,  President John Dramani Mahama expressed confidence that Ghana is actively taking steps to overcome its current economic difficulties.

Despite the ongoing challenges, Mahama emphasized Ghana’s commitment to restoring economic stability through strategic initiatives and key international partnerships.

The president also underscored the robust relationship between Ghana and China, acknowledging China’s pivotal role as a development partner. Mahama’s comments highlighted the importance of global cooperation in addressing both national and international issues.

“We are working diligently to address the economic challenges we face,” Mahama said. “We are grateful for our partners, including China, and as we move forward, we must continue to foster cooperation, ensuring that the benefits of these partnerships are shared equitably across our nation.”

In his speech, Mahama also reflected on the broader global context, noting the multitude of challenges the world faces, from economic uncertainty to climate change. Drawing inspiration from the lantern festival, he stressed that even amid adversity, hope and resilience remain crucial. “Unity and perseverance,” he added, “will guide us through these challenging times and help us create a brighter future.”

Through his remarks, Mahama reinforced the importance of international collaboration in Ghana’s economic recovery and sustainable development.
